Bootstrap and Responsive Web Design: Optimise for Mobile

B2B Websites
May 1, 2025
Bootstrap icon beside a digital website layout wireframe with grid blocks and image placeholders

Designing for a Mobile World

Chances are, the last website you visited wasn’t on a desktop. Whether browsing on a smartphone during the morning commute or checking a service page on a tablet, people now expect websites to adapt without a second thought. That shift has made responsive web design not just a helpful extra—but a baseline requirement.

The goal is simple: create digital spaces that feel effortless to use, regardless of device. And with tools like Bootstrap offering structure and flexibility, building mobile-friendly sites has become more accessible than ever. For designers and developers focused on keeping pace with user expectations, understanding how to apply these tools effectively is key.

What Is Responsive Web Design?

Responsive web design is a method of building websites that adapt seamlessly across devices—from large desktop screens to compact mobile phones. It uses fluid grids, flexible images, and media queries to adjust layout and functionality to the user’s environment.

This approach is different from simply scaling down a desktop layout. It prioritises usability, ensuring that users can engage with content comfortably, whether they’re using a touchscreen or a mouse. As mobile traffic continues to rise, responsive design is no longer optional; it’s essential for any website hoping to compete in today’s digital landscape.

While this blog focuses on Bootstrap, the core principles of responsiveness apply across platforms. For example, here’s a comprehensive guide to responsive design in Webflow, which explores how to apply these same concepts using another leading tool.

Why a Mobile-First Approach Matters in 2025

A mobile-first strategy begins by designing for smaller screens and then scaling up. With mobile devices becoming the primary access point to the web for many users, this approach ensures fast load times, accessible navigation, and an overall experience tailored to the devices people use most.

In practice, mobile-first design often improves SEO. Google prioritises mobile-friendly websites in its search rankings, and users are more likely to stay engaged when a site performs well on their devices. It’s a win-win: better usability and increased visibility.

Mobile and desktop screens with UI layout elements under Bootstrap logo, illustrating responsive web design

Bootstrap: A Flexible Framework for Responsive Web Design

What Is Bootstrap?

Bootstrap is a popular open-source front-end framework that helps developers build responsive and mobile-first websites more efficiently. Originally developed by Twitter, it includes a robust toolkit of pre-designed components, layout structures, and interactive elements—all built on HTML, CSS, and JavaScript.

It’s widely used because it simplifies the development process, reducing the need for custom code while still allowing for a high degree of customisation. If you're interested in the latest updates, this guide on Bootstrap 6 explores the new features and why they matter for modern websites.

Key Features of Bootstrap

Flexible Grid System

Bootstrap’s grid system is based on CSS flexbox and divides pages into up to twelve columns. This system enables developers to create layouts that adjust naturally depending on screen size. The use of breakpoints—ranging from extra small to extra-large—helps content respond to various devices, from mobile phones to widescreen monitors.

Pre-Designed UI Components

Bootstrap comes packed with components like buttons, forms, modals, and navbars. These elements not only streamline the design process but also ensure visual and functional consistency across a site. They’re built with accessibility in mind and follow responsive design best practices out of the box.

Built-in Media Queries

Developers can quickly apply different styles for different devices using Bootstrap’s built-in media queries. These queries detect screen size and adjust design accordingly, reducing the need to write custom CSS from scratch.

JavaScript Plugins and Custom Themes

Bootstrap includes JavaScript plugins for interactive elements such as dropdowns and carousels. Developers can further personalise websites by adjusting Sass variables to match a brand’s unique identity without overriding core functionality.

Building Mobile-First Websites with Bootstrap

Using the Grid System for Layouts

Bootstrap’s container, row, and column classes provide a reliable foundation for creating layouts that flex with screen size. Developers can set column widths and reconfigure the layout at different breakpoints, ensuring smooth transitions between device types.

For example, a two-column layout on desktop might stack into a single column on mobile, improving readability and usability without additional coding.

Enhancing Development with Pre-Built Components

From navigation bars to alert boxes, Bootstrap’s ready-made UI components simplify the creation of polished interfaces. These modules follow responsive layout principles and can be used with minimal effort, making them especially valuable in projects with tight timelines.

Using Media Queries and Breakpoints

Bootstrap’s responsive breakpoints—such as xs, sm, md, lg, and xl—allow developers to adapt styles depending on screen width. This is vital for refining layouts, hiding or revealing elements on certain devices, and optimising the user journey based on context.

Adapting Content for Mobile with Custom Themes

Bootstrap allows designers to implement responsive branding by adjusting styles, fonts, and colour schemes across device types. The end result is a cohesive, user-friendly website that maintains its identity regardless of how it’s accessed. For projects that require more than just a standard setup, a custom web design approach can extend Bootstrap’s flexibility even further—aligning functionality and aesthetics with specific business needs.

Bootstrap logo next to a stack of wireframe web layouts on a digital interface background

Bootstrap in Custom Web Design and Development

How B2B Websites Use Bootstrap Effectively 

For B2B organisations, Bootstrap offers the speed and flexibility needed to deliver tailored experiences. Developers can rapidly build scalable websites with consistent layouts, intuitive navigation, and robust responsiveness—all critical components for businesses engaging across digital touchpoints.

Advantages of Bootstrap in B2B Web Projects

  • Streamlined development: Pre-built tools reduce development time

  • Scalable architecture: Modular design supports business growth

  • Cross-device functionality: Ensures accessibility for all users

  • Consistent branding: Custom themes align with brand identity

  • Browser compatibility: Works well across major browsers

To see how a web developer in Australia applies these principles in practice, explore our recent Everton Park web development project.

Best Practices When Using Bootstrap

Integrating CSS and HTML5 Seamlessly

Bootstrap works well with HTML5 features and other CSS frameworks, allowing for integration of rich media and semantic markup. This improves accessibility, clarity, and content structure.

Following Modular Design Principles

Using reusable components not only simplifies development but also ensures consistency throughout the site—an important factor in long-term maintenance.

Accessibility Considerations

Always prioritise accessibility by using Bootstrap’s built-in ARIA roles, keyboard-friendly navigation, and appropriate contrast settings. Regular accessibility audits help ensure compliance and inclusivity.

Advanced Considerations and Performance

When Bootstrap Isn’t Enough

In some cases, Bootstrap might not offer the flexibility required. Combining it with other CSS tools or writing custom code can help bridge the gap between standard frameworks and unique brand needs.

Website Speed and Responsiveness

Optimising performance involves more than layout. Minimise HTTP requests, enable lazy loading for media, and compress images to reduce load times—critical for retaining mobile users.

Scaling Responsively

Scalable web design isn’t just about making something look good today—it’s about making sure it grows with a business. Bootstrap’s modular structure helps support this by keeping design elements organised and easy to expand.

Final Thoughts: Keeping Web Design Human and Mobile-Friendly

Responsive design is no longer just a trend—it’s a necessity. Bootstrap continues to be one of the most practical tools for creating mobile-first websites that are both visually consistent and functionally flexible. For businesses building with users in mind, frameworks like Bootstrap offer the balance between efficiency and customisation.

As users increasingly expect seamless, mobile-first experiences, understanding tools like Bootstrap will remain essential for developers and designers alike.

If you’ve found this useful, there’s more to explore. Dive into other articles on responsive design, UX, and web development best practices—or reach out if you’re curious about applying these strategies to your own projects. It all starts with a conversation.

Versatility Across All Platforms

  b2b websites blends technical excellence with creative collaboration. Let’s help you bring your  website to life with the precision and efficiency that only seasoned professionals can provide.
Contact B2B today
b2b-whatapp-icon
Customer Care Team
Typically replies in a few hours
Customer Care Team
Hi there
How can i help you today?
whats-app-icon
Start Whatsapp Chat
whatsapp-cta-icon